Training needs for sugarcane pest control of field extension workers in Sing Buri sugar industry
1996
Pongmanit Thaitae
Purpose of this thesis was to study some Basic characteristics of field extension workers and their training needs for sugarcane pest control as well as problems and suggestions concerning guidance and extension of sugarcane pest control. The population in this study were 108 field extension workers in Sing Buri sugar industry. The results of this thesis were as follows. The average age of field extension workers in Sing Buri sugar industry were 31.38 years. Most of them graduated with diploma in agriculture. Their average working years was 3.88 and average salary was 4,876.15 baht/month. They were responsible for the average field of 3,662.61 rai. They earned average additional income of 23,668.51 baht and average bonus of 7,889.52 baht. Their average debts were 61,998 baht. They needed pest control training at the high level in 19 topics and at the moderate level in 10 topics. They viewed that suitable duration of training should be 3-6 days and August was suitable month for training. As for problems in extension of sugarcane pest control, the technical problems that were frequently found during extension were about protection and elimination of sugarcane diseases because there were a lot of epidemic diseases. The problem frequently found when visiting farmers was that the supporting fund for sugarcane production was not sufficient. In addition, problem of target farmers was lacking of knowledge in sugarcane disease control. After hypotheses had been tested, field extension workers with different ages, levels of education, area of working, working years, additional income, bonus, debt and different levels of knowledge in sugarcane pest control needed training differently.
